    10hectorvernet

    I guess you gotta be French

    Die Hard, but instead of an ex-cop it's a couple of window cleaners. I'm French and was literally raised by this movie. It's one of the most iconic French comedies. It was innovative, extremely well written and overall just a gem in my opinion. Obviously you have to like Eric and Ramzy's comedy style, which is basically two absurdly stupid characters put in the middle of an otherwise very serious situation. One of the things that really get me with this movie is that it doesn't fall in the usual parody movie trap of having everything other than the comedy be eclipsed, or just bad. All the characters are great in their own ways, all of the writing is very sharp, the acting and cinematography are on point, the music is fantastic. That contrast between the two moronic main characters and the world they evolve in is really what does it for me. And it was made on a pretty tight budget.

    But I guess the comedy doesn't translate well. Based on the reviews here, it seems like non-French people generally strongly dislike this ? If you're French and you haven't seen this film, what are ya doing. If you're not French, you should probably still give it a go if you like absurd comedies. But I personally don't like Dumb & Dumber that much, so maybe this type of thing just doesn't really cross the culture barrier.

    Anyway I love it and it's one of the movies I've rewatched the most.
    5fehrsp

    Imagine "Dumb and Dumber" meets "Die Hard"

    "Dis 'Hard'" was what the posters for this movie read, a "clever" french play on the American film "Die Hard". La Tour Montparnasse is a blatant spoof of "Die Hard" by the two incredibly popular French comedians, Eric and Ramzy. I'm not sure there is an American equivalent to these guys, but Martin Lawrence comes to mind. Eric and Ramzy combine to create the "mis-matched" comedy pair: one tall, the other short, one loud, the other shy. Although this pairing has been done over and over and over again, Eric and Ramzy are good natured and playful and are enjoyable to watch.

    The film, on the other hand, isn't so easy to watch. La Tour Montparnasse is the sole "skyscraper" in Paris, the natural setting for a French "Die Hard" knockoff. The movie starts off with Eric and Ramzy playing window washers on the side of the building. They are wasting time spitting off the building and trying to flirt with the women inside the building. Within 3 minutes of this movie, you have a rough idea of the intelligence behind it. It is dumb. It is childish. It has pretty low production value. But, there are some decent gags.

    The scenes I thought were quite funny was a matrix spoof (yes, it's pretty topical humor) and an incredible spoof of Bruce Lee's "Game of Death." This joke probably flies by most of the audience (I think I was the only one laughing in the theater) but it is hilarious. There is also a decent "Speed" spoof at the very end of the film.

    The negatives to the film? It is pretty dang homophobic. Apparently in France it is still okay to have homophobia in the films, but I found it a little jarring. There is a constant banter between Eric and Ramzy about "gayness." The production values for the film are also quite low, but considering comedies usually aren't huge budget blockbusters anyway, it's not such a huge deal. Maybe the most blatant problem is the film's tendency to act like "Scary Movie": it comes off as a series of gags with no real connection between them. The plot is thiiiiiiin and it serves only to bridge the gags or spoofs in the film.

    Overall, I would give the film a middle of the road 5. It's not great, it's not terrible, and any Bruce Lee fan should definately watch the great spoof near the last half hour of the film.
    1Rave-Reviewer

    Dumb and Dumber meets Die Hard

    A witless spoof of Die Hard, and other movies when it runs out of ideas, one of France's top 2001 box office draws feature the inexplicably popular TV comedy duo of Judor and Bedia, who have seemed to model themselves on the Dumb and Dumber sub-genre of comedy. The effect is rather like watching Norman Wisdom in the same film as Jerry Lewis while each tries to slow down and dilute his schtick to make the other look better. One excruciating routine has one of them repeatedly failing to notice as the other dirties the window he has just cleaned. The rather cute Foïs has her features fixed in an expression of contempt throughout, though it might be boredom, and Riaboukine is wasted in the Alan Rickman role. The hardware and production values are in fact pretty well matched to the Die Hard films (even the colour processing is the same), but it only makes one long all the more for someone to either shoot or defenestrate these two cretins and put us out of our misery. In brief, this one definitely does not travel.
